Jesus Advance is the home of Dr. Ron Larson's Bible teaching ministry at Calvary Chapel. His passion is to make disciples and build churches that fully reflect Jesus Christ in the world! Ron has planted churches, taught in Seminary and Bible schools, and trained church leaders around the world. He has Master of Divinity (M.Div.) and Doctor of Ministry (D.Min.) degrees from Fuller Theological Seminary and serves as the lead pastor at Calvary Chapel Northland in Kansas City, Missouri (USA).
